Added checking of pipes within same network. The Carlson line of software comes with 64-bit capabilities, is Windows 7 compatible, and works on AutoCAD® and IntelliCAD. Here’s how it all works with HydroCAD:. Start with a drawing, preferably georeferenced.

Define the Hydrologic Soil Group areas and identify them with plain CAD text, A, B, C, or D. Define Ground Covers areas as closed polylines on user-defined layers. Define and label watersheds and longest flow paths for Tc calculations.
